在现代信息技术的快速发展中,操作系统作为计算机系统的核心,其安全性一直是人们关注的焦点。Qubes OS,作为一种基于虚拟化的安全操作系统,因其独特的安全设计而受到广泛关注。然而,任何系统都存在安全漏洞,Qubes OS也不例外。本文将深入探讨Qubes OS的安全漏洞,分析现代操作系统的安全风险,并提出相应的应对策略。
一、Qubes OS简介
Qubes OS是一款基于Xen虚拟化技术的操作系统,其设计理念是将操作系统分割成多个独立的虚拟机(称为“盒子”),每个盒子运行不同的应用程序和任务。这种设计使得系统中的不同部分相互隔离,从而提高了系统的安全性。
二、Qubes OS安全漏洞分析
1. 漏洞类型
Qubes OS的安全漏洞主要包括以下几类:
- 虚拟化漏洞:由于Qubes OS依赖于Xen虚拟化技术,因此Xen本身的漏洞可能会影响到Qubes OS的安全。
- 内核漏洞:操作系统内核是系统最核心的部分,内核漏洞可能导致系统崩溃或被恶意利用。
- 应用程序漏洞:运行在Qubes OS上的应用程序也可能存在安全漏洞,如缓冲区溢出、SQL注入等。
2. 漏洞案例
以下是一些Qubes OS的安全漏洞案例:
- CVE-2019-6111:该漏洞允许攻击者通过Xen虚拟化技术获取宿主机的权限。
- CVE-2019-11434:该漏洞可能导致Qubes OS的某些组件被恶意利用。
- CVE-2020-0688:该漏洞可能导致攻击者通过Qubes OS的某些应用程序获取敏感信息。
三、现代操作系统安全风险
1. 虚拟化技术风险
随着虚拟化技术的广泛应用,虚拟化漏洞成为现代操作系统面临的主要安全风险之一。攻击者可以利用这些漏洞突破虚拟机隔离,进而攻击宿主机。
2. 软件供应链攻击
软件供应链攻击是指攻击者通过篡改软件包或库,将恶意代码注入到系统中。这种攻击方式隐蔽性强,难以检测和防御。
3. 恶意软件攻击
恶意软件攻击是现代操作系统面临的最常见安全风险之一。攻击者通过恶意软件窃取用户信息、破坏系统或进行其他恶意行为。
四、应对策略
1. 定期更新和打补丁
及时更新操作系统和应用程序,修复已知的安全漏洞,是提高系统安全性的重要手段。
2. 使用安全配置
遵循最佳安全实践,对操作系统进行安全配置,如禁用不必要的网络服务、设置强密码等。
3. 采用多层次安全防护
结合多种安全防护措施,如防火墙、入侵检测系统、防病毒软件等,构建多层次的安全防护体系。
4. 加强安全意识培训
提高用户的安全意识,避免因操作失误导致的安全事故。
五、总结
Qubes OS作为一种安全操作系统,在提高系统安全性方面具有显著优势。然而,任何系统都存在安全漏洞,我们需要时刻关注现代操作系统的安全风险,并采取相应的应对策略,以确保系统的安全稳定运行。
